Subject: [Qemu-devel] [PATCH 05/13] block: Hide HBitmap in block dirty bitmap interface
Date: Mon, 4 Jan 2016 18:27:06 +0800 [thread overview]
Message-ID: <1451903234-32529-6-git-send-email-famz@redhat.com> (raw)
In-Reply-To: <1451903234-32529-1-git-send-email-famz@redhat.com>
HBitmap is an implementation detail of block dirty bitmap that should be hidden
from users. Introduce a BdrvDirtyBitmapIter to encapsulate the underlying
HBitmapIter.
A small difference in the interface is, before, an HBitmapIter is initialized
in place, now the new BdrvDirtyBitmapIter must be dynamically allocated because
the structure definition is in block.c.
Two current users are converted too.
